AREA 6 INTERNATIONAL SPEECH AND EVALUATION CONTEST

 AREA 6
INTERNATIONAL SPEECH
AND EVALUATION CONTEST

Ashfield Club – Sunday 22nd February 2026

Concord West Toastmasters Club was very ably represented by 
Sriraman Annaswamy with his International Speech – 
"My Grandpa's Monster"




Sri was supported by Members of Concord West Toastmasters;
IPP Lana, VPPR Matthew, President Mario and VPE John

Sri went on to win both Contests and will represent Concord West Club and Area 6 at what will be the last Lachlan Division international Speech and Evaluation Contests prior to the realignment brought about by the amalgamation of District 90 and District 70 from July 2026.

Our Meeting was originally relegated to the alfresco area
of The Concord due to overlapping bookings.
However we were only one formal Speech in and we were besieged
by a large gaggle of 'tweeny' Volleyballers.

So decision was made to relocate via a brief stop off 

in a partitioned part of the large Function Area.

However the PA shared with the function in the other half could not be disconnected

So we moved to the Boardroom which was subsequently vacated 

over 30 minutes later than we had been told.

CONCORD WEST TOASTMASTERS – END OF YEAR CELEBRATION DINNER – TUESDAY 16th DECEMBER 2025

END OF YEAR CELEBRATION DINNER 

Buddha Racka Thai Restaurant

An evening of great food, fun and conversation. as well as recognition and celebration of achievements throughout the year.


TRIPLE CROWNS

2 Members achieved Triple Crowns (3 Pathway Levels completed in the Toastmaster Year 2024-2025.

John H

Mario G

SERVICE AWARDS

The first round of Recognitions went to the following Members for 'Years of Service'. Members who do not have a Concord West Name Badge received a Toastmaster Name Badge and a Certificate;

Our End of Year Social afforded Concord West Club the opportunity to celebrate and record a very unique circumstance that our Club currently (in the 2025 year) holds all 4 Area 6 Speech Trophies and all 4 Lachlan Division Trophies.

The 2024-2025 International Speech Trophy held by Sriraman Annaswamy

The 2024-2025 Evaluation Trophy held by John Hughson

The 2025-2026 Humorous Speech Trophy held by John Hughson

The 2025-2026 Table Topics Trophy  held by John Hughson


The opportunity also arose to thank and acknowledge a long standing Member and former Club Treasurer Melody who is moving to the north side with a presentation of flowers and our deepest gratitude.
